Ошибка в команде Perl oneline

perl -pi -e 's|\x20|; s|\x90|' log.bin

дает мне эту ошибку

Backslash found where operator expected at -e line 1, near "s|\x20|; s|\"
syntax error at -e line 1, near "s|\x20|; s|\"
Execution of -e aborted due to compilation errors.

Что я делаю не так? строка предназначена для замены всех байтов с 0x20 на 0x90 ...

0
задан Johannes Pille 2 May 2012 в 13:04
поделиться